  • Two games I have been working on, mainly as tests to utalise certain aspects of Construct I had never bothered about before. Star Combat Simulator will be a top down space ship combat game, with heavy focus on managing parts of your ship and weapons.

    Pixel Explorer is also a game set in space, but with less focus on combat. The game will generate a random universe in which the player can fly his human craft to. The player can mine different minerals, capture lifeforms and commence diplomacy with alien races. Combat is not a heavy focus here. There is a lack of HUD at the moment, but beleive me, the game looks far better in motion, I am experimenting with 3D backrounds, planets, asteroids etc.
